She may just be having some low blood sugar if she is not eating much. Try to get her to eat and see her her temperature goes back up. Also, sometimes when the pups drop the temperature may go down and then back up. Just keep a close eye on her. |
Please confine her when she is nearing her due date....do not allow her to walk all over the house....this is conducive to finding puppies in all kinds of little hiding places, if she has them early. My females are confined and isolated from other animals starting two weeks prior to due date...that gives momma plenty of time to get used to her whelping pen, so she is comfortable in that specific crate and the box she is going to care for her little family in. She is settled and calm when she goes into labor. |

Hi new on here but have been showing and bettering the breed for some time now. Some females will have the tempeture drop like mentioned so many times. But one of my females once was driving me crazy with the up and down on tempeture. I was just starting to breed. My mentor said not all females go by the tempeture rule. Some can have a normal tempeture and whelp just then. good luck on your litter. |
